Iron Man Vol 1 30

The Menace of the Monster-Master!!

At a Japanese conference, after Iron Man demonstrates electro-magnetic power uses, he is approached by Prof. Goro Watanabe, his daughter Fujiko, and his assistant Toru Tarakoto, who ask if he'd like to accompany them on a trip to a nearby island that's emitting strange energy readings. When they arrive, they're attacked by Zoga, a beast of myth. The beast is too powerful for Iron Man so everyone flees; afterwards Zoga lands and is greeted by a Chinese general and his soldiers. Revealed as a robot, Zoga's cockpit opens up and the Monster-Master emerges, and discusses taking over Japan. Stark and Prof. Watanabe's attempts to warn the Japanese Defense Council about Zoga are dismissed, so they prepare their own plans. Soon after, the Monster-Master attacks Japan with Zoga, but Iron Man defeats the robot by reflecting its eye-lasers back at it, destroying it. Iron Man pulls the Monster-Master out of the wreck, revealing him to be Toru.
